助记词恢复的钱包地址为什么会变?
记不住的助记词
最近我在和朋友聊加密货币的时候,朋友说了一件让我很困惑的事:“我用助记词恢复钱包地址,结果发现居然变了!这到底是怎么回事?”我当时也是一脸懵,毕竟助记词应该能把我的资产恢复如初啊。于是,我开始深入研究这个问题,想和大家分享一下我的发现。
助记词的基本概念
首先,我们得理解一下助记词的概念。助记词其实就是将长串的数字和字母变成好记的词语,目的就是为了方便我们记住。比如说,有些钱包用 12 个或者 24 个单词的组合来表示,这样记起来会容易不少。而这组单词,理论上是独一无二的,可以帮助你恢复钱包里的资产,听起来是不是很简单?
钱包地址为何会变化
那么,是什么导致恢复的钱包地址会变呢?其实,主要有两个方面的原因。第一个是钱包的生成方式。很多钱包使用的是 HD(Hierarchical Deterministic)技术,这种方式允许我们从同一个助记词生成多个钱包地址。听起来很高大上,但其实就是一组地址,可以说有点类似于一个文件夹里有很多文件。就算你用同一个助记词,每次生成的钱包地址都可以不同。
HD 钱包的原理
HD 钱包的魅力在哪里呢?假设你用某个助记词生成了5个地址,你发现其中一个地址里进了个大钱,但你又想保持匿名,想把这笔钱转到另外一个地址。你可以从同样的助记词中生成一个新的地址,再把钱转过去。这样的话,原来的地址和新的地址就完全不同,且不容易被其他人追踪。通过这一点,大家可以看到,地址的变化其实是为了提高隐私保护。
第二个原因:钱包类型及网络环境
另一个原因,就是不同的钱包或者网络环境可能会导致地址的变化。像比特币和以太坊这样的区块链,其地址生成算法都不一样。所以,若你是从一个比特币钱包恢复到一个以太坊钱包,结果肯定会不一样。再比如你在不同的设备上使用助记词,比如手机和电脑,也有可能会生成不同的钱包地址。就像我们在苹果手机上写的东西,在安卓手机上可能用不一样的形式展现。
个人的经验分享
其实,这个问题不仅仅是个理论上的探讨,我本人也曾经碰到过类似的情况。记得那时候,我把一个钱包的助记词发给了朋友,让他帮我转个币。可是当他用助记词恢复后,发现地址完全不对,结果害得我整晚都没睡好,生怕自己的币转错了。后来经过仔细对比,我们才发现是因为我们用的是不同的设备和软件。说真的,那一刻我差点崩溃。
如何避免钱包地址变化
那么,我们怎么样才能避免这种情况呢?我总结了几条经验给大家:首先,尽量在同一个钱包应用中使用助记词,这样地址的兼容性会好很多。其次,选购主流且值得信赖的加密货币钱包,这样生成的地址和管理方式通常更稳定。最后,最好能了解一下你使用的钱包是怎样生成地址的,了解其背后的原理会让你更放心。
以后的改进方案
对于这些体验,我也有些想法,未来的区块链钱包应该能做得更好,比如增加用户教育,明确告诉用户使用助记词可能会导致哪些后果。同时,还可以开发一些工具,帮助用户检查恢复的钱包地址是否正确,让大家在使用过程中更加安心。想想看,如果有这样的功能,那真是太友好了。
总结一下?其实没有
不过,对于这方面的问题,其实每个人都有自己的看法。你可能会问,那我难道得一直留意着这些细节吗?其实不然,正常情况下,只要你用同一套助记词在同一个钱包上操作,一般都不会存在太大的问题。我们只是希望能在复杂多变的区块链领域,更多地分享经验,减少不必要的烦恼。有什么疑问的,咱们就一起讨论吧!
最后,虽然我还是新手,但这些经历让我对助记词及钱包地址的变化有了更深的理解。如果你还有其他疑问,或者有什么经验,务必和我分享哦!